Why did socrates kill himself?

Respuesta :

Аноним Аноним
  • 20-01-2020

Answer:

Socrates has been convicted of corrupting the youth of Athens and introducing strange gods, and has been sentenced to die by drinking poison hemlock. Socrates uses his death as a final lesson for his pupils rather than fleeing when the opportunity arises, and faces it calmly.
